What is Agricultural Wheel

 

 

The Agricultural Wheel is an essential element in that it bears the weight of your tractor and transmits engine torque to the tyre, then to the ground.It must be proportionally sized, taking into account the weight of your tractor with its implements and your engine power. If not, there is a risk that the rim may break.The engine effectively transmits torque to the rim, the metal of the rim is subjected to a turning force which is borne by the thickness of metal in the rim, and if it is too thin or unsuitable for the combined forces of the engine torque and the weight, it may crack.

Types of Agricultural Wheel
 

Fix Welded Wheels
Fix weld wheels are perhaps the most common type of wheel used in agricultural implements. These wheels are made for heavy load applications.

 

Adjustable Wheels
Adjustable wheels are similar to fix weld wheels but with adjustable track widths option. Different types of lug/ loop designs are used for creating the various track widths into the wheels.

 

Galvanized Wheels
Galvanized wheel is steel that has been coated with a layer of zinc in order to protect it from corrosion. Galvanized steel is often used for agricultural implements because it is very durable and rust-resistant. The benefit of using galvanized wheels for your agricultural implement wheels is that you won't have to worry about them rusting or corroding over time.

Q: What was the Agricultural Wheel that formed in 1882?

A: The Agricultural Wheel was a cooperative alliance of farmers in the United States. It was established in 1882 in Arkansas. A major founding organizers of the Agricultural Wheel was W. W. Tedford, an Arkansas farmer and school teacher.

Q: What is the maintenance of tractor tires?

A: Regular cleaning and lubrication of tractor tyres are essential for their maintenance. After a day's work in the fields, remove any mud, debris, or foreign objects stuck in the tyre treads. Cleaning the tyres prevents the buildup of material that can lead to imbalances and uneven wear.

Q: How do you store tractor tires?

A: Store the agricultural tyres away from light and variations in temperature (ideally inside). Keep the tyres away from chemical substances and sources of ozone. Avoid direct contact with cold and wet surfaces. Change the position of the tyres regularly (1/4 of a turn each month).
